Orin Swift Cellars

8 Years in the Desert Zinfandel Blend 2023

This Zin blend is very nice. The Zinfandel is sublime and the Syrah is soft. There is also a smattering of Petite Sirah in the mix. Such a silky mouthfeel, opulent fruit, vanilla, a bit of spice and chocolate. Round tannins and a very smooth finish. Orin Swift bottles weigh a ton! Really liked this wine.

Chauvenet-Chopin

Clos Vougeot Grand Cru Pinot Noir 2011

Much better than my last btl about 1.5 yrs ago. Oak better integrated, but still.char and a touch of pyrazine...which I guess I would call vintage character. On the palate: good acidity, roasted strawberry and excellent density with fantastic spice. Soft tannin on the juucy and spicy finish. Excellent. — 5 years ago
